Sales Team Leader with Italian

Meet your
Recruiter!

Claudia Chifflier
  • English
  • French
  • Catalan
  • Spanish

Do you want to elevate your career to the next level? Are you looking for a fast-paced environment where you can make a meaningful impact by empowering others to overcome challenges and achieve their fullest potential? If so, we are looking for you!

Join a dynamic organization that values collaboration and prioritizes the wellness of its team members.

Languages

  • Native level of Italian
  • Professional level of Spanish
Barcelona

Main Responsibilities

  • Manage and build a cohesive and effective Sales team 
  • Make sure the team meets the goals of the company and the expectations of the clients
  • Ensure active listening to your team, analyse their needs and find solutions
  • Encourage continuous learning and professional growth within the team
  • Facilitate effective communication within the team and between the team and other parts of the organization
  • Make decisions to ensure smooth operations

Core Skills/experience

  • Previous experience leading a Sales team
  • Previous experience in Sales
  • Proficiency in Excel and CRM
  • Excellent communication skills
  • Analytical and result-oriented attitude
  • Ability to make decisions with autonomy
  • Ability to build strong interpersonal relationships
  • Critical and creative attitude when overcoming challenges

What’s on offer

  • Health Insurance
  • Hybrid working model with offices in Barcelona
  • Flexible working hours
  • Permanent contract
  • An international and supportive team

Our recruitment process

  • Step 1: Excel test
  • Step 2: Interview with one of our Recruiters
  • Step 3: Interview with our client’s Talent Acquisition team
  • Step 4: Business Case
  • Step 5: Interview with our client's Team Director